Congressman Jefferson Reacts to Former FEMA Director Michael Brown’s Senate Hearing Testimony

“I was appalled to learn today that over 20 agencies were aware of the levee breaches in New Orleans as early as Monday, August 29th – the day Katrina hit. It is clear that if the Administration knew sooner that our levees had breached, they should have acted sooner. By providing major federal resources immediately, the Administration could have avoided the major loss of life and property with which our city must now cope. Obviously, the delay in federal action made the situation much worse."
